I have both and prefer the Eotech primarily because all I have to do is push one button and it is at my preset light level.  My NV compatible Aimpoint needs several clicks to be at the appropriate setting.  At the range they both work well but the 65 MOA ring on the Eotech is pretty much minute-of-badguy's-chest, which IMO is great for up close.  So with this said, my house gun with a weapon light has an Eotech and my outdoors gun has the aimpoint.

Aimpoint, easier to operate the knob with winter gloves on than the buttons.

The batteries last a decade.

Feels much more sturdy than an EoTech does to me.

Can hit 1 MOA with an M1a at 100 yards with a 2moa dot Comp M3.

I used the aimpoint in Iraq and I hated it.....the knob was terrible and bent after about 5 months of work..... the big thumbscrew on the mount was consatntly hung up on vehicals ot molle gear....The dot was too big and would just get too bright causing washout and other problems, it was about as good as iron sites....

That being said I am now a civilian and have 1 eotech & two bushnell holosites all are great products and work amazingly well..

I swear by eotechs it I had to go back to the box again I would bring mine with me


edit to add: Mount the eotech farther forward and you will find better field of view and a larger reticle patern for quicker acquisition without increasing size of the aiming dot
